Decentralized Autonomous Organizations: Internal Governance and External Legal Design should be assessed against Kaal's source-bound claim that The DAO of DAOs uses a duality of internal and external governance: internal governance runs on reputation token staking, while external legal relationships are handled by a legal wrapper that represents the DAO of DAOs in real world legal contexts. The current metadata indicates a plausible connection through DAO governance, decentralized autonomous organization, Decentralized Autonomous Organizations Internal Governance and External Legal Design, but the defensible response is a qualification until the source text confirms agreement, scope, methods, and limitations.
